What restrictions did Spain place on American Trade
alexdok [17]
They closed the Mississippi River to all American commerce in 1784. This made it difficult for American farmers to get their goods to international markets. Spain would eventually allow Americans to use the river, but placed a tariff for the privilege. <span />

Jelaskan fungsi dewan perhimpunan di athens​
Sergeu [11.5K]

Answer:

The Assembly was the regular opportunity for all male citizens of Athens to speak their minds and exercise their votes regarding the government of their city. It was the most central and most definitive institution of the Athenian Democracy.The assembly was responsible for declaring war, military strategy and electing the strategoi and other officials. It was responsible for nominating and electing magistrates, thus indirectly electing the members of the Areopagus.
